Output 5b9532d6678926528ec0aa3414a71478ad16d62dda087c3d834c668332dcfec2:7

value
6079000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b17d17ec96965ab26bfef44838ecdc57a8df647 OP_EQUALVERIFY OP_CHECKSIG
address
16PTQFEHxzky38XVufhKSqi2271mQeQHvC
transaction
5b9532d6678926528ec0aa3414a71478ad16d62dda087c3d834c668332dcfec2
spent
true